7th Circuit Finds Police Officer’s Testimony On Coded Text Messages Proper

Mealey's (January 13, 2021, 9:56 AM EST) -- CHICAGO — An Illinois district court properly admitted a police officer’s testimony that coded language used in text messages was evidence that a man was involved in illicit drug activity, the Seventh Circuit U.S. Court of Appeals ruled Jan. 8, affirming the man’s conviction....
